Before a Clinic can be Booked In the Portal

 

Juvonno_Clinic_Portal_Booking.gif

 

Before a clinic can be booked in the patient portal you will have to adjust the clinic settings to show the clinic available.

 

Steps

Go to Settings > System & Company Settings Section > Clinics.

Open the Clinic(s) you would like to have booked through the portal.

Book in Portal field: Set this to Yes, then click on Save.

Portal Settings

 

General - Portal Settings

 

Portal_Settings.png

Enabled

Is the portal (turned on - enabled) or (turned off - disabled)

Theme

(Not Available with updated Portal version)

Allow Public Signup

This option allows a patient that has not been to your clinic before booking an appointment and create a patient profile. This option is only available when the portal is enabled. 

Add/View Medical Profile This option allows the patient to log into the portal and add their medical profile and records that have been set such as medical history, nutrition, physical profile allergies and more.
Mandatory General Practitioner

In order for a patient to complete their profile, they must enter a general practitioner name. They will not be able to finish or book appointments without this field filled. This is strictly optional.

Mandatory
Date of Birth

In order for a patient to complete their profile, they must enter a date of birth.

Mandatory Gender

In order for a patient to complete their profile, they must select their gender from the drop-down.

Intake Form
Complete Notification

This option sends an email to the patient's clinic when they complete or update an Intake Form on the Portal.

Portal
Signup Notification

This option sends an email to the default clinic email address when a new patient signs up.

Portal Login URL

The URL which patients can log in to your Juvonno portal. To be embedded within 'book appointment' links on the website and social media.

 

 

Scheduling - Portal Settings

 

 

Slot Availability

Is the portal (turned on - enabled) or (turned off - disabled)

If you want to select specific times the practitioner is available in the portal set this to Yes. There is a further described below under the Availability Tab section.

Public Appointment Booking

This option shows a Book an Appointment button on the portal before a patient logs in using their Username and Password.

Auto-Accept
Portal Appointments

 

Yes - The patient books the appointment, you have a Pending tab on your schedule dashboard where you will be able to accept or decline appointment with a note to the patient.

No - The system automatically confirms the appointment.

 

Pending Appointment
Email Address


This option allows the patient to log into the portal and add their medical profile and records that have been set such as medical history, nutrition, physical profile allergies and more.

 

Apply Default Insurance

This option will automatially apply the patients Default Insurance you selected on their profile to apply to the appointment block.

Hours Prior to Book

This sets the number of hours prior to an open appointment slot that a patient can book an appointment through the portal.

Hours Prior to Cancel Reschedule

Set the number of hours prior to the appointment that a patient can cancel an appointment through the portal. This should be in-line with your cancellation policy.

The reschedule option on the portal is based on the setting that controls cancelling appointments on the portal.


Since an appointment must be cancelled to be rescheduled, the option is removed when the patient isn't permitted to cancel through the portal:
Settings > General > Portal > Scheduling > Hours Prior To Cancel

 

 

 

Scheduling Consent  - Portal Settings

 

 

Enabled

When enabled, the patient will be presented with a checkbox and some text asking them to confirm that they have read and understood the consent form. If the 'required' toggle is set to 'yes' below, they will not be able to continue without checking the box.

Scheduling Consent Required

This forces the patient to accept the consent before continuing with their booking.

Required Every Time

If this setting is enabled, the patient will be required to confirm their consent every time they book an appointment. If not, they will only be asked to confirm once.

Consent Document

Choose a PDF or MS Word document that will be displayed for patients upon consent to an appointment booking.

 

 

Messages - Portal Settings

 

 

These sections allow to you type custom text. Be creative and welcome your patients to the portal, inform them of the services and type/quality of practitioners and services you provide or anything you would like them to know about your clinic.

You can also use your portal to tell patients about new practitioners coming on board or promotions/discounts you may be offering as well as hours of operations, stat holidays etc.

 

Appointment Booking Message

This message will appear at the top of the first screen as the patient begins to book their appointment.

Portal Login Page Message

This message will appear on the login page, before the patient logs into their home page.

Secure Home Page Message

This message will appear on the home page once the patient has logged in to the portal.

Public Book Thank You Message

This message will appear after a person has booked an appointment without logging in.

Secure Book Thank You Message

This message will appear after a person has booked an appointment if they are logged in.

Widgets - Portal Settings

 

 

Insurance Totals

Shows a list on the secure portal home page of the patient's insurance balances.

Loyalty Point Balance

Shows the current loyalty point total for the patient on the secure portal home page. This will only show if the loyalty point module is enabled.

Outstanding Invoices

Shows a list on the secure portal home page of the patient's outstanding invoices, and the balance owing.
